Wenshen Tang is a scholar working on Mechanical Engineering, Aerospace Engineering and Materials Chemistry. According to data from OpenAlex, Wenshen Tang has authored 26 papers receiving a total of 310 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 25 papers in Mechanical Engineering, 9 papers in Aerospace Engineering and 7 papers in Materials Chemistry. Recurrent topics in Wenshen Tang’s work include Advanced Welding Techniques Analysis (17 papers), Aluminum Alloys Composites Properties (16 papers) and Aluminum Alloy Microstructure Properties (9 papers). Wenshen Tang is often cited by papers focused on Advanced Welding Techniques Analysis (17 papers), Aluminum Alloys Composites Properties (16 papers) and Aluminum Alloy Microstructure Properties (9 papers). Wenshen Tang collaborates with scholars based in China, Germany and Finland. Wenshen Tang's co-authors include Xinqi Yang, Shengli Li, Yongsheng Xu, Huijun Li, Ting Luo, Boxue Du, Alexander Hartmaier, Napat Vajragupta, Ruilin Wang and Ruilin Wang and has published in prestigious journals such as Materials Science and Engineering A, Journal of Materials Science and Applied Surface Science.
